I just downloaded opera-stable_56.0.3051.99_amd64.deb
from https://www.opera.com/de/download
and ran
sudo dpkg -i opera-stable_56.0.3051.99_amd64.deb
It complained about some missing dependencies so I ran
sudo apt-get -f install
sudo apt install apt-transport-https
then reran
sudo dpkg -i opera-stable_56.0.3051.99_amd64.deb
anyway, am worried about what evil that has done to my otherwise clean debian distribution and how to undo it. At the least it has replaced the firefox which used to launch from the icon at the bottom of xfce with itself.
Actually, the command under the button is:
exo-open --launch WebBrowser %u
..so no opera keyword.
How do I get it back to how it was and if necessary clean up anything else bad which it might have done?
